How much do credit acceptance j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for credit acceptance in the United States is $23.19,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.23 and $25.96 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Credit anal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Credit Analyst, you need strong financial analysis skills, attention to detail, and a bachelor's degree in finance, accounting, or a related field. Familiarity with credit risk assessment tools, financial modeling software, and spreadsheet applications like Excel is typically required. Excellent communication, critical thinking, and problem-solving abilities help analysts present findings and build client relationships. These skills are crucial for accurately assessing creditworthiness and supporting sound lending decisions that minimize risk.

Credit Acceptance primarily focuses on providing auto financing solutions and managing credit portfolios within finance companies and dealerships. An Auto Loan Specialist typically works directly with customers at dealerships, assisting with loan applications and explaining financing options. While both roles involve auto finance, Credit Acceptance is more centered on credit management and approval processes, whereas Auto Loan Specialists focus on customer service and sales in the dealership environment.

What are some typical challenges a Credit Acceptance analyst might face in their day-to-day responsibilities?

Credit Acceptance Analysts often juggle multiple tasks such as evaluating credit applications, ensuring compliance with lending policies, and communicating with both customers and internal teams. A common challenge is balancing the need for thorough risk assessment with the company's service standards and turnaround times. Analysts must also stay updated on changing regulations and use critical thinking to identify potential fraud or inconsistencies in applications. Collaboration with sales, underwriting, and customer service teams is crucial to resolve issues and deliver efficient decisions.

What does a Credit Acceptance representative do?

A Credit Acceptance representative typically works for a financial services company that specializes in auto loans, particularly for customers with subprime credit. Their main responsibilities include reviewing loan applications, assisting customers and dealerships with financing options, and ensuring compliance with company and regulatory standards. Representatives also provide customer service by answering questions, resolving issues, and guiding clients through the loan process. The role requires strong communication, attention to detail, and an understanding of financial products.
